About Juan L. Delcán

Juan L. Delcán is a scholar working on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and Surgery, having authored 68 papers that have together received 5.1k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Cardiac Valve Diseases and Treatments (19 papers), Cardiac Arrhythmias and Treatments (17 papers), Cardiac Imaging and Diagnostics (17 papers), Acute Myocardial Infarction Research (15 papers), Atrial Fibrillation Management and Outcomes (14 papers), Cardiovascular Function and Risk Factors (11 papers), Coronary Interventions and Diagnostics (11 papers) and Cardiac electrophysiology and arrhythmias (10 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(3.6k citations), Surgery (3.7k citations) and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ging (1.9k citations). Juan L. Delcán has collaborated with scholars based in Spain, United States and Argentina. Frequent co-authors include Håkan Emanuelsson, Antonio Colombo, Patrick W. Serruys, Wolfgang Rutsch, Pierre Materne, J J Goy, Carlos Macaya, Marie‐Angèle Morel, Ulrich Sigwart and Paul van den Heuvel.
